Alternative Therapies For Fighting Eczema Hold Promise, But Dermatologists Caution They Are No Substitute For Proven Medical Treatments

Dermatologists warn that eczema sufferers risk developing more severe symptoms, such as red, itchy rashes, by seeking relief from alternative medicines and delaying conventional treatment. However, some alternative therapies used in conjunction with clinically tested medical treatments are believed to be effective. Dermatologist Dr. Lio cautions that non-medical therapies are not governed by the FDA.
